入职阿里巴巴,成为年薪百万阿里P7高级架构师需要必备哪些技术栈

本文涉及的产品
Redis 开源版,标准版 2GB
推荐场景:
搭建游戏排行榜
传统型负载均衡 CLB,每月750个小时 15LCU
云数据库 Tair(兼容Redis),内存型 2GB
简介: 大家都知道,阿里P7高级技术专家,基本上是一线技术人能达到的最高职级,也是很多程序员追求的目标。达到 年入百万的P7 Java高级架构师级别,不仅要具备优秀的编程能力和系统设计能力,在技术视野和业务洞察力方面,也要有很深的积淀。

大家都知道,阿里P7高级技术专家,基本上是一线技术人能达到的最高职级,也是很多程序员追求的目标。达到 年入百万的P7 Java高级架构师级别,不仅要具备优秀的编程能力和系统设计能力,在技术视野和业务洞察力方面,也要有很深的积淀。

最近技术大牛 马士兵老师 邀请他一位在阿里做架构师的朋友,整理出一份xmind——“Java高级架构师所需技术栈”,对于需要提升技术能力的初中级Java程序员们,提供一些学习方向上的借鉴和参考。学完以下所有技术,面试阿里P7岗,拿到年薪50W真的没什么问题

阿里P7Java技术栈

  • 多线程与高并发编程
  • spring,ioc入门与详解
  • maven的简单构建、spring AOP
  • spring中的循环依赖、代理方式讲解
  • springBoot mvc项目结构 开发 热部署
  • springBoot web项目整合数据源、Thymeleaf
  • 项目开发-Thymeleaf、Jpa、Bootstrap
  • mybatis整合SpringBoot、mybatis-generator
  • 企业项目开发中的角色、流程、任务分配
  • pageHelper、翻页、Example使用、异步表单
  • 开发-RBAC、表设计、YAML、项目配置
  • 开发-RBAC前后端、mybatis多表、thymeleaf
  • 开发-Odata、Restful、SpringBoot文件上传
  • 开发-权限认证、Icheck、Mybatis plus
  • Tengine原理、对比、部署、配置、虚拟主机
  • Tengine 反向代理、负载均衡、 session共享 等
  • Tengine 动静分离 https SSL 非对称加密
  • Nginx OpenSSL 自签名证书 xca FastDFS介绍
  • FastDFS 部署 原理 整合Nginx JavaAPI
  • 高并发负载均衡:网络协议原理
  • 高并发负载均衡:LVS的DR,TUN,NAT模型推导
  • 高并发负载均衡:LVS的DR模型试验搭建
  • Spring Environment原理
  • 高并发负载均衡:基于keepalived的LVS高可用搭建
  • Spring监听器
  • FastDFS keepalived 高可用 zookeeper
  • dubbo demo、角色、 RPC、原理 、RMI
  • 项目微服务拆分 注册中心、dubbo admin
  • dubbo下的微信公众号项目
  • Spring AOP原理
  • dubbo核心配置 聚合项目构建
  • 亿级流量多级缓存架构方案、openresty Lua
  • 多线程与高并发编程一
  • redis的string类型&bitmap
  • redis的list、set、hash、sorted_set、skiplist
  • redis消息订阅、pipeline、事务、modules、布隆过滤器、缓存LRU
  • redis的持久化RDB、fork、copyonwrite、AOF、RDB&AOF混合使用
  • redis的集群:主从复制、CAP、PAXOS、cluster分片集群01
  • redis的集群:主从复制、CAP、PAXOS、cluster分片集群02
  • redis开发:spring.data.redis、连接、序列化、high/low api
  • zookeeper介绍、安装、shell cli 使用,基本概念验证
  • zookeeper原理知识,paxos、zab、角色功能、API开发基础
  • zookeeper案例:分布式配置注册发现、分布式锁、ractive模式编程
  • 亿级流量多级缓存高并发系统架构实战
  • Spring Cloud微服务概况及注册中心搭建
  • 多线程与高并发编程 六
  • 亿级流量多级缓存高并发系统架构实战四
  • 微服务间调用和熔断降级
  • 微服务网关、链路追踪、配置中心的使用
  • 亿级流量多级缓存高并发系统架构实战五
  • 多线程与高并发编程七
  • 亿级流量多级缓存高并发系统架构实战六
  • Spring源码总结
  • 网约车项目实战一:乘客用户功能
  • 亿级流量系统架构之限流
  • 网约车项目实战二:接口安全设计和分布式锁
  • 亿级流量系统架构之扩容
  • 亿级流量系统架构之降级
  • JVM入门及class文件格式
  • Java NIO
  • 亿级流量系统架构之分布式事务原理
  • 亿级流量系统架构之实战流量分发层
  • 网约车项目实战三:消息队列应用
  • 详解Class加载过程
  • 亿级流量系统架构之实战域名与https
  • 电商系统详情页PLAN A
  • 静态文件生成-rsync
  • NIO之ByteBuffer
  • 网约车项目实战四:项目小结
  • Java内存模型
  • 静态化文件生成业务流程及技术选型解决方案
  • Arica开发实战 CRUD
  • Netty 之NIO selector
  • 内存屏障与JVM指令
  • 静态文件生成
  • html同步,生成首页,批量生成,健康检查
  • 单机事务,并发锁,压力测试
  • Netty之内存管理
  • Java运行时数据区和常用指令
  • html架构的应用场景,扩容,静态分页实现
  • 分页逻辑2,动态加静态,lua访问mysql
  • resty_template,静态文件补偿机制实现
  • 亿级流量高并发项目总结
  • 精通mysql调优大师班
  • JVM调优必备理论知识-GC Collector-三色标记
  • PS+PO调优实战
  • Netty课程小结
  • JVM调优实战
  • 区块链-比特币、挖矿、炒币原理
  • 区块链-以太坊原理
  • 区块链-幽灵协议,pow,pos
  • JVM实战调优2
  • 区块链-DPOS共识协议,solidity智能合约开发
  • 区块链-solidity手写加密货币
  • 消息中间件-ActiveMQ
  • 垃圾回收算法串讲
  • apache dubbo
  • spring cloud
  • service mesh微服务设计的学与思
  • JIRA和findbugs
  • jenkins+代码检查

高并发多线程亲写书籍

京东亿级流量系统架构

  1. 交易型系统设计的一些原则
  2. 负载均衡与反向代理
  3. 隔离术
  4. 限流详解
  5. 降级特技
  6. 超时与重试机制
  7. 回滚机制
  8. 压测与预案
  9. 应用级缓存
  10. HTTP缓存
  11. 多级缓存
  12. 连接池线程池详解
  13. 异步并发实战
  14. 如何扩容
  15. 队列术
  16. 构建需求响应式亿级商品详情页
  17. 京东商品详情页服务闭环实践
  18. 使用0penResty开发高性能Web应用
  19. 应用数据静态化架构高性能单页Web应用
  20. 使用OpenResty开发W eb服务
  21. 使用0p enResty开发商品详情页

需要获取以上高清大纲等学习资料,源码,视频,架构资源可以点击此处来获取就可以了!

马士兵/java/python/AI/从零到年薪百万免费

以上所有技术为顶级架构师“马士兵老师”对广大程序员对标“阿里P7”高级架构师年薪50W岗位定制的架构体系图,由于文章图片有限,需要完整的架构体系图可以点击此处来获取就可以了!

大家都知道马士兵老师为行业顶级大牛,很多程序员都是看马士兵老师的Java入门课程入门成为java程序员的,如果需要马士兵老师的架构资料,可以点击此处来获取就可以了!

备注:(架构视频包含:Spring boot、Spring cloud、Dubbo、Redis、ActiveMQ、Nginx、Mycat、Spring、MongoDB、ZeroMQ、Git、Nosql、Jvm、Mecached、Netty、Nio、Mina、性能调优、高并发、tomcat 负载均衡、大型电商项目实战、高可用、高可扩展、数据库架构设计、Solr 集群与应用、分布式实战、主从复制、高可用集群等高端视频。)

需要获取以上高清大纲等学习资料,源码,视频,架构资源可以点击此处来获取就可以了!

相关实践学习
基于Redis实现在线游戏积分排行榜
本场景将介绍如何基于Redis数据库实现在线游戏中的游戏玩家积分排行榜功能。
云数据库 Redis 版使用教程
云数据库Redis版是兼容Redis协议标准的、提供持久化的内存数据库服务,基于高可靠双机热备架构及可无缝扩展的集群架构,满足高读写性能场景及容量需弹性变配的业务需求。 产品详情:https://www.aliyun.com/product/kvstore     ------------------------------------------------------------------------- 阿里云数据库体验:数据库上云实战 开发者云会免费提供一台带自建MySQL的源数据库 ECS 实例和一台目标数据库 RDS实例。跟着指引,您可以一步步实现将ECS自建数据库迁移到目标数据库RDS。 点击下方链接,领取免费ECS&RDS资源,30分钟完成数据库上云实战!https://developer.aliyun.com/adc/scenario/51eefbd1894e42f6bb9acacadd3f9121?spm=a2c6h.13788135.J_3257954370.9.4ba85f24utseFl
相关文章
|
1月前
|
SQL 存储 分布式计算
ODPS技术架构深度剖析与实战指南——从零开始掌握阿里巴巴大数据处理平台的核心要义与应用技巧
【10月更文挑战第9天】ODPS是阿里巴巴推出的大数据处理平台,支持海量数据的存储与计算,适用于数据仓库、数据挖掘等场景。其核心组件涵盖数据存储、计算引擎、任务调度、资源管理和用户界面,确保数据处理的稳定、安全与高效。通过创建项目、上传数据、编写SQL或MapReduce程序,用户可轻松完成复杂的数据处理任务。示例展示了如何使用ODPS SQL查询每个用户的最早登录时间。
90 1
|
4月前
|
监控
阿里商旅账单系统架构设计实践问题之对账模型包括内容问题如何解决
阿里商旅账单系统架构设计实践问题之对账模型包括内容问题如何解决
|
4月前
|
数据格式
阿里商旅账单系统架构设计实践问题之系统设计中的清结算系统问题如何解决
阿里商旅账单系统架构设计实践问题之系统设计中的清结算系统问题如何解决
|
4月前
|
存储 分布式计算 Hadoop
阿里巴巴飞天大数据架构体系与Hadoop生态系统的深度融合:构建高效、可扩展的数据处理平台
技术持续创新:随着新技术的不断涌现和应用场景的复杂化,阿里巴巴将继续投入研发力量推动技术创新和升级换代。 生态系统更加完善:Hadoop生态系统将继续扩展和完善,为用户提供更多元化、更灵活的数据处理工具和服务。
|
4月前
|
搜索推荐 Java
阿里商旅账单系统架构设计实践问题之需要账单数据表达式引擎问题如何解决
阿里商旅账单系统架构设计实践问题之需要账单数据表达式引擎问题如何解决
|
4月前
|
监控 供应链 搜索推荐
阿里商旅账单系统架构设计实践问题之账单详情数据未同步会带来问题如何解决
阿里商旅账单系统架构设计实践问题之 账单详情数据未同步会带来问题如何解决
|
4月前
|
存储 搜索推荐
阿里商旅账单系统架构设计实践问题之差错处理(平账)的主要目的问题如何解决
阿里商旅账单系统架构设计实践问题之差错处理(平账)的主要目的问题如何解决
|
6天前
|
缓存 负载均衡 JavaScript
探索微服务架构下的API网关模式
【10月更文挑战第37天】在微服务架构的海洋中,API网关犹如一座灯塔,指引着服务的航向。它不仅是客户端请求的集散地,更是后端微服务的守门人。本文将深入探讨API网关的设计哲学、核心功能以及它在微服务生态中扮演的角色,同时通过实际代码示例,揭示如何实现一个高效、可靠的API网关。
|
4天前
|
Cloud Native 安全 数据安全/隐私保护
云原生架构下的微服务治理与挑战####
随着云计算技术的飞速发展,云原生架构以其高效、灵活、可扩展的特性成为现代企业IT架构的首选。本文聚焦于云原生环境下的微服务治理问题,探讨其在促进业务敏捷性的同时所面临的挑战及应对策略。通过分析微服务拆分、服务间通信、故障隔离与恢复等关键环节,本文旨在为读者提供一个关于如何在云原生环境中有效实施微服务治理的全面视角,助力企业在数字化转型的道路上稳健前行。 ####
|
5天前
|
Dubbo Java 应用服务中间件
服务架构的演进:从单体到微服务的探索之旅
随着企业业务的不断拓展和复杂度的提升,对软件系统架构的要求也日益严苛。传统的架构模式在应对现代业务场景时逐渐暴露出诸多局限性,于是服务架构开启了持续演变之路。从单体架构的简易便捷,到分布式架构的模块化解耦,再到微服务架构的精细化管理,企业对技术的选择变得至关重要,尤其是 Spring Cloud 和 Dubbo 等微服务技术的对比和应用,直接影响着项目的成败。 本篇文章会从服务架构的演进开始分析,探索从单体项目到微服务项目的演变过程。然后也会对目前常见的微服务技术进行对比,找到目前市面上所常用的技术给大家进行讲解。
15 1
服务架构的演进:从单体到微服务的探索之旅